Review
Drake (Treasure) has a dedicated review/guide available. You can find it by following the link below.
Provides a huge ATK buff to all Shotgun allies.
Provides decent Max Ammo buffs to self and to all SGs.
Improved value of Hit Rate buff means more core hits against certain bosses.
Has an insanely high damage small area nuke in her new Burst Skill.
Provides herself with Attack Damage buffs during her Burst, making her a DPS/Support hybrid.
Provides slightly higher Burst Generation with her Skill 2.
Can be used as an off-burst or in-burst; Phase 2 or Phase 3 both are fine for Drake (ideally P3 if she is Bursting).
Improves the SG team’s standing in the meta.
Ammo buffs do not refill ammo automatically, so they are hard to utilize by SG teams unless the team has Noir or B.Alice.
Her high damage nuke can often miss targets unless it is manually placed.
Still no major improvement in performance for Campaign stages.
Costly to build since she requires an SR15 SR doll.
Restricted to the SG team for best potential.
Feeds into Scarlet and Jackal in PvP since she is an SG unit.
When you control her, you will feel how annoying her burst aiming is.
Succeeds in being a Villain — forcing us to play the RNG-filled SG team for Solo Raid if competitive. Wait, shouldn’t that be a pro?

Priority
High
Since she is a DPS or sub-DPS, you will want to full OL her. Like other DPS, gear level is also important, but only upgrade those that give ATK growth.

Bastion generally pairs best with Shotgun units due to synergy with Tove, Noir, and Bunny Alice (if applicable). It also helps ensure they are able to shoot an entire Full Burst. A close-second alternative and sometimes not even inferior depending on team investments and composition. Might be better if your Resilience has a significantly higher level compared to Bastion.

Another SG Team ft. DrakeT
Mode: Union / Solo Raids || Element: All
This team shines in Wind Weak and potentially Iron/Fire Weak. In this team, we run Noir as a DPS and as an ammo support to recharge the whole team's ammo (possibly to the point of infinite shooting) as well as boost their overall ATK. This team also comes with Damage Taken and unparalleled teamwide healing. Depending on the circumstances (i.e. whether Hit Rate is more important), Drake's or Noir's Burst Skill might be used.
Guilty can replace Soda: Sparkling Bunny.

Run It Down ft. 5 SGs
Mode: PVP || Element: All
This is a team for ATK only. The idea behind this team is that you counter a defensive team without proper P1 protection, i.e. to undo their Burst Chain or simply just to kill them before they can retaliate. No, this team cannot reach Full Burst, but who needs that if the enemy is already dead? Alternatively, you can use Pepper/Viper or any other B1/B2 as deemed necessary if you do need Full Burst. Or use Makima if you counter SG teams alike (defending SG hits P5). You can slot in SAnis and PrivM and replace any of the SGs above if they are more invested. You can also use LaplaceTr because she also hurts right off the bat, not to mention the splash. Ultimately, investments (and element counters) determine damage dealt, and CP is important for avoiding stat penalty from CP deficit. Do pay attention to Burst Gen (if you are planning to Full Burst with this team).
